What We Are

We are the Creekbend Neighborhood Association (CENA).  The purpose of CENA is to promote the common good and welfare of the residents in Creekbend Estates.  Some examples of this are:
  • Maintaining the common areas entering and surrounding the neighborhood
  • Participating in the Crime Watch Program of the City of Plano
  • Monitoring governmental activities and civic issues that affect the neighborhood
CENA itself has no real property and and is a totally voluntary, unincorporated, nonprofit association of neighbors.


What We Aren't

We are not an HOA (Home-owners' association).
  • We have no special enforcement authority
  • Our bylaws explicitly prevent CENA from participating enforcement activities
  • We do not collect mandatory fees

Funding & Expenses

CENA is funded completely by voluntary donations from neighbors.  There are no mandatory fees, but there are mandatory expenses each year.  Some of our key expenses:
  • Maintenance of our common grounds and entryways
  • Planting, replanting, and ongoing care of landscaping in common areas
  • Maintenance and repair of irrigation systems for common grounds and entryways
  • Repairs to common grounds/areas
  • Major upgrades (e.g., converting to drip irrigation systems)
